| Grant Comments | Power listed is conducted. This device must be restricted to work related operations in an Occupational/Controlled RF exposure Environment, not exceeding a maximum transmitting duty factor of 50%. All qualified end-users of this device must have the knowledge to control their exposure conditions and/or duration to comply with the Occupational/Controlled MPE limit and requirements. A label, as described in this filing, must be displayed on the device to direct users to specific training information for meeting Occupational Exposure Requirements. SAR compliance for body-worn operating configurations is limited to the specific belt-clip/holster/accessories tested for this filing. Use of other accessories for body-worn operations requires no metallic component in the assembly and must provide at least 2.5 cm separation between the device, including its antenna, and the users body. End-users must be informed of the body-worn operating requirements for satisfying RF exposure compliance. The highest reported SAR levels are: Head: 6.34 W/kg for 50% Duty Cycle; Body: 6.99 W/kg for 50% Duty Cycle. Power output is continuously variable from the value listed to 0.8W. |
